Dr. A. Galloula is a pioneering researcher in the field of interventional vascular medicine, with a primary focus on the non-invasive treatment of deep venous thrombosis (DVT). Their major contributions center on developing and validating novel ultrasound-based and robotic-assisted techniques for venous recanalization, offering promising alternatives to traditional thrombolytic therapies. In a landmark 2020 study, Dr. Galloula demonstrated that high-frequency ultrasound can effectively and non-invasively recanalize DVT in a swine model, achieving 25 citations and establishing a foundation for future clinical applications. Earlier work in 2018 introduced robotic-assisted thrombotripsy, showcasing high-accuracy venous recanalization in a porcine model—a proof-of-concept that underscores their commitment to precision and minimally invasive interventions.
